C.2 SIM_2251 Modbus register list

To use the Modbus Test program and view the contents of SIM_2251 registers, set the Register Mode to “Daniel,” as noted in Table C-1.

For a complete list of register assignments, both SIM_2251 and User_Modbus, print a GC Config Report. See “Generating a GC Configuration Report” on page 5-65for more information.

Note

The information in the following tables is derived from engineering specification number ES-17128-005, “Model 2251 Enhanced Specification Chromatograph Controller Modbus Communication Indices.”
